Output e2aba22c481eb224a97b210d7c048e8a15b67495fbbd8d70305248ce959bd926:3

value
30140499
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48586b7dce49020d6b807ee8fc82fb7bfea84818 OP_EQUALVERIFY OP_CHECKSIG
address
17bXaLLMSZxVDUWUC3nQWM9pvoo1QzxEq1
transaction
e2aba22c481eb224a97b210d7c048e8a15b67495fbbd8d70305248ce959bd926
confirmations
448422
spent
true